Understanding the High Cost of Installation Errors
Transformers are designed to operate under precise conditions, and any deviation introduced during installation can jeopardize their functioning. One of the most common mistakes is poor site preparation. Uneven surfaces or inadequate foundation design can lead to mechanical stress and structural failure over time. Transformers are heavy equipment, and any imbalance or instability at the base level may result in alignment issues and internal damages during operation.
Another frequent issue is improper electrical connections. Loose or poorly torqued terminals can cause arcing, overheating, and insulation breakdowns. In the worst-case scenario, these faults can lead to transformer fires or explosions. Such events not only damage the equipment but can also disrupt the entire substation and affect power supply to a wide area.
Installation mistakes can also arise from incorrect handling and lifting of transformers. Using inappropriate lifting points or equipment can deform the transformer structure or displace critical internal parts like windings and tap changers. These issues may not be immediately visible but can lead to unexpected failures during service.
The Importance of Environmental Considerations
Environmental factors also play a significant role in transformer performance. Failing to account for site-specific conditions such as temperature, humidity, and dust exposure during installation can shorten the lifespan of the transformer. For instance, neglecting proper oil filtration and contamination control in dusty environments can degrade insulation systems and lead to internal arcing.
Incorrect placement of radiators and cooling systems during installation can also compromise thermal performance. Overheating not only reduces efficiency but accelerates insulation aging, which eventually leads to costly repairs or replacement. Ensuring proper ventilation, distance from heat sources, and adherence to manufacturer-specified clearances are essential to prevent such thermal issues.
Role of Testing and Commissioning
One of the most critical yet frequently overlooked steps in transformer installation is proper testing and commissioning. Omitting insulation resistance tests, turns ratio checks, or failure to verify grounding systems can leave latent faults undetected. These hidden issues can cause future operational failures, often at the most inconvenient times, leading to extended outages and high repair costs.
Choosing qualified experts for commissioning ensures that all electrical and mechanical parameters are within safe and specified limits. Regulatory Compliance and Safety Risks
Non-compliance with national and international standards during transformer installation can attract legal penalties, operational shutdowns, or loss of licenses. Safety protocols, such as proper earthing, protection relay settings, and arc-flash hazard assessments, are mandatory for all high-voltage equipment.
Improper insulation clearances or the use of substandard materials not only breach regulations but also expose technicians and staff to severe risks, including electric shocks and equipment failure. Prioritizing regulatory adherence is not only a legal necessity but also a moral obligation to ensure workplace safety.
